House to house is the memoir of david bellavias time as a soldier in iraq and in particular his and his units experiences in the second battle of fallujah, which took place in november of 2004 and was arguably the bloodiest battle in the iraq war. Bellavia and his men confronted an enemy who had had weeks to prepare, boobytrapping houses, arranging ambushes, rigging entire city blocks as explosiveladen kill zones, and even stocking up on steroids.
